Based on the characters of Archie Comics, and developed by Roberto Aguirre-Sacasa,“Riverdale” is an American teen drama television series following the gang including Cole Sprouse, K.J. Apa, Lili Reinhart, and Camila Mendes while they navigate the troubled waters of sex, romance, school, and family, teen and become entangled in a dark mystery, the first season of which aired on January 26, 2017.

Season five of “RIVERDALE” which aired earlier this year, began with our characters’ final days as students at Riverdale High. From an epic Senior Prom to a bittersweet Graduation, there are a lot of emotional moments and goodbyes yet to come—with some couples breaking up, as everyone goes their separate ways to college—or elsewhere.
Then, we will redock with our gang as young adults, all returning to Riverdale to escape their troubled pasts. And life—and romance—will only be more complicated now that they’re in their twenties. . . .
After few months of hiatus mid-season, Episode 11 failed to air in July, and premieres Wednesday, August 11, 2021, on The CW. The series is also available for streaming on Netflix.
The Official synopsis for “Strange Bedfellows” reads— In the aftermath of the prison break at Hiram’s jail, Archie leads the charge to round up the remaining convicts on the loose. Tabitha reaches out for Betty’s help when she realizes Jughead is missing. When Penelope re-enters the fold, Cheryl becomes suspicious of her true intentions.
